appreciable level
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"appreciable level"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a significant or noticeable degree of something, often in contexts related to measurement or assessment. Example: "The study found that there was an appreciable level of improvement in the participants' performance after the training program."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"appreciable level", consider the audience's understanding of 'appreciable'. In technical contexts, this might imply a statistically significant value, whereas in general writing, it suggests something easily noticeable.
Common error
Avoid using "appreciable level" without context, as its meaning is subjective. Over-reliance on vague qualifiers weakens your writing. Offer measurable data to support claims and provide context around what is considered 'appreciable'.

FAQs
How can I use "appreciable level" in a sentence?
You can use "appreciable level" to describe a significant or noticeable amount of something. For example, "There was an appreciable level of improvement after the new training program".
What are some alternatives to "appreciable level"?
Alternatives include "noticeable degree", "significant amount", or "considerable extent", depending on the context.
Is it better to use "appreciable level" or "significant level"?
Both "appreciable level" and "significant level" are acceptable. "Appreciable" emphasizes that something is noticeable or considerable, while "significant" emphasizes its importance or consequence. Choose the word that best fits the specific meaning you want to convey.
Can "appreciable level" be used in formal writing?
Yes, "appreciable level" is suitable for formal writing. It is a clear and professional way to indicate that something is present or has changed to a noticeable degree.
